More than 80 teenagers from all over Ukraine took part in AJT Sport Day

More than 80 teenagers from all the regions of Ukraine took part in the sports competition AJT Sport Day, which was held from October 24 to October 26 in Kiev. The event was organized by the international network of the Jewish teenage clubs “Active Jewish Teens” (AJT).

Both amateurs and professional athletes could take part in this sports event. For three days, football, basketball, volleyball, table tennis, checkers / chess, athletics and cheerleading professional coaches were involved in training the participants and in holding competitions for children aged 13-17.

According to the organizers, the children’s interest in sports has increased significantly compared to previous years.

“The most popular disciplines were volleyball, cheerleading and 3 km running race. In addition, the teenagers themselves were very active: they prepared a lesson on a sports film and then conducted a quiz with gifts. This proves once again that our teenagers are interested not only in leadership and Jewish values, but also in sports, ”said Igor Tysiachka, AJT coordinator in Ukraine.

At the end of this sports competition there was a cheerful Zumba party. And all the participants went home with cups, medals, certificates and branded T-shirts.
